The ten-thousand-foot phantom of the Ancestor of Magic cast a heavy sense of oppression over all living beings in Honghuang. Every mighty figure could sense Luohou’s fury; it was clear that he was in the grip of a towering rage. Luohou’s appearance stirred all the mighty figures. They were eager to witness a battle between Luohou and the Heavenly Dao. After all, if the Heavenly Dao was obstructing Taixuan from attaining the Dao and refused to bestow the necessary merit, how could Luohou let it slide? Should Luohou and the Heavenly Dao clash, it would undoubtedly result in mutual destruction. While the loss of the Heavenly Dao would be disastrous for ordinary beings, it would be immensely advantageous for the Quasi-Saint mighty figures. Consequently, every one of these Quasi-Saints hoped for such a conflict, ideally leading to the annihilation of both parties. If the Heavenly Dao were destroyed, Dao Ancestor Hongjun would perish; if the Ancestor of Magic were destroyed, the Magic Dao would naturally decline. Either outcome would fundamentally reshape the landscape of Honghuang. However, these calculating figures were overthinking. Luohou’s rage was not directed at the Heavenly Dao. Even if the Heavenly Dao held a bias against the Magic Dao, it would never obstruct Taixuan’s attainment of the Dao at such a critical moment—not when the very collapse of Honghuang would be at stake. As long as the Heavenly Dao desired the existence of Honghuang, it would not act so recklessly.
